I have trailered the NoBones all over the state in the past
17 years... 1988 Jeep Grand Wagooner, 1990 Dodge Ram Charger, 1992 3/4 Ton Suburban, 1999 1/2 Ton Dodge Ram
(with after market Posi) Have launched at every conceivable ramp all over the state with no problems with any of the above vehicles. If you set your trailer up right you should not have any problems. Even the sand ramp at Channel 2 in the Keys at MM 76. I have a Continental tandem axle trailer with 8 12 inch Stoltz keel rollers and 8 donut Stoltz rollers at the stern and bow chock bunks. I also rigged the trailer with a Power Winch 912 with a stainless cable from the switch to the end of the trailer. And a 12 inch wide piece of rough sawn cedar walk board the length of the trailer. On the shafts of the rollers I drilled out the centers and added zirc fittings to be able to grease the rollers. I wanted a 1 man operation to launch and load. If you want pics, "Ken-Do", (New name for the Sceptre) just let me know. When I launch, the back wheels of the trailer only have to be wet to the hubs.
